Corporate SocialResponsibility (CSR) is a term that has been gaining a lot of attention in
recent years. It refers to the actions that companies take to improve the lives
of people in the communities in which they operate. Many companies have
realized that being socially responsible is not only good for the community but also good for their bottom line. For Non-Governmental Organizations (NGOs),
CSR is an important way to raise
awareness and funds for their causes.
One of the most important CSR activities that companies can
undertake is to support NGOs. NGOs are organizations that work to improve the
lives of people in their communities. They often focus on issues such as
poverty, education, and health care. Many companies have recognized the
importance of NGOs and have begun to support them through various CSR activities.
One of the most popular ways for companies to support NGOs
is through financial donations. Many companies make large donations to NGOs
each year to support their work. This can help NGOs to continue their important
work and can also help to raise awareness about the issues they are working on.
Another popular CSR
activity is volunteering. Many companies encourage their employees to
volunteer their time to help NGOs. This can be a great way for employees to get
involved in their communities and to make a positive impact. Many NGOs are
always in need of volunteers, and companies can help to fill this need by
encouraging their employees to volunteer.
Companies can also support NGOs by promoting their causes.
Many companies use their marketing channels to raise awareness about important
issues and to encourage people to support NGOs. This can be a great way for
companies to show their support for NGOs and to help raise awareness about
important issues.
